About
A C12-14 fatty alcohol with 9 EO units — a workhorse mild emulsifier in body washes and lotions. CIR safe-as-used; main caveat is supplier 1,4-dioxane control. Low irritation makes it formulator-favorite for sensitive skin lines.
Function
Skin benefits
- Mild O/W emulsifier
- Compatible with anionic surfactants
- Reliable in body washes
- Low cumulative irritation
Known concerns
- Trace 1,4-dioxane manufacturing control
- Mild eye sting in concentrated cleansers
